mirror of
https://github.com/hwchase17/langchain.git
synced 2025-07-05 20:58:25 +00:00
accept openai terms (#9826)
This commit is contained in:
parent
c1badc1fa2
commit
610f46d83a
@ -674,18 +674,18 @@ def _create_template_from_message_type(
|
|||||||
Returns:
|
Returns:
|
||||||
a message prompt template of the appropriate type.
|
a message prompt template of the appropriate type.
|
||||||
"""
|
"""
|
||||||
if message_type == "human":
|
if message_type in ("human", "user"):
|
||||||
message: BaseMessagePromptTemplate = HumanMessagePromptTemplate.from_template(
|
message: BaseMessagePromptTemplate = HumanMessagePromptTemplate.from_template(
|
||||||
template
|
template
|
||||||
)
|
)
|
||||||
elif message_type == "ai":
|
elif message_type in ("ai", "assistant"):
|
||||||
message = AIMessagePromptTemplate.from_template(template)
|
message = AIMessagePromptTemplate.from_template(template)
|
||||||
elif message_type == "system":
|
elif message_type == "system":
|
||||||
message = SystemMessagePromptTemplate.from_template(template)
|
message = SystemMessagePromptTemplate.from_template(template)
|
||||||
else:
|
else:
|
||||||
raise ValueError(
|
raise ValueError(
|
||||||
f"Unexpected message type: {message_type}. Use one of 'human', 'ai', "
|
f"Unexpected message type: {message_type}. Use one of 'human',"
|
||||||
f"or 'system'."
|
f" 'user', 'ai', 'assistant', or 'system'."
|
||||||
)
|
)
|
||||||
return message
|
return message
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user